摘要
In this paper, we use fuzzy logic speed control with two ahead prediction torque control of induction motor drive for high performance. Transient response, torque ripple and switching frequency are main features in control induction motors. Predictive torque control performs the best tradeoff between above features. Also the fuzzy controller is applied to make a better transient response since it reduces speeds overshoot. Moreover, some changes in fuzzy strategy as a new idea to help the predictive torque control to reduce torque distortions. To verify the performance of this control, Matlab simulation results are demonstrated and a comparison with a conventional PI controller is provided.
